Aurelia
A haven of eternal Harvest Season, Aurelia is home to vibrant forests, rolling hills, and the musky smell of earth. Instead of a formal settlement, the landscape is dotted with individual wood cabins, forming a scattered community of Faians who appreciate the peace and quiet. Residents live a largely self-sufficient lifestyle, sustained by the island’s bounty of fruit trees, berries, and an incredible variety of unique mushrooms. Indeed, foraging is a central part of the Aurelian way of life, connecting local Faians to the land as well as each other.
SIZE: Small
SHAPE: Irregular
EDGE COMPOSITION: Rocky cliffs, grasslands.
TERRAIN: Coniferous forests, grasslands.
NATURAL RESOURCES: Timber, root extracts, berries, fruit, mushrooms, herbs.
SOIL FERTILITY: Medium
WATER PURITY: Medium
CLIMATE: Temperate. Moderate rainfall and cool, breezy temperatures.
STORM FREQUENCY: High
PRECIPITATION TYPES: Rain, snow, dew.
OCEAN CURRENTS: Varying with the seasons.
WIND PATTERNS: Chilly, crisp, intensity varies with the seasons.
